Job Description
Role title – Inspector
Contract duration – 6 months
Contract type – PAYE via Umbrella – INSIDE IR35
Hours – 37 hours, Split between Nights, Afters + Days (overtime achievable)
Location – Derby
Assystem Energy & Infrastructure are recruiting for a number of Inspectors to work at one of our major clients in Derby on a 6 month contract basis.
You will play a key role in contributing to the clients business objective of delivering systems, products and components on time to the customer. Whilst operating in accordance with safety requirements, within established procedures and in compliance with the documented method of manufacture. Applying appropriate Health and Safety practice and maintaining a safe environment against stringent requirements at all times is vital. Working as part of an integrated team to achieve cell targets is critical to success, you will also need to focus on continuous improvement across the products and processes.
Key Accountabilities:
- Work to Technical Instructions to deliver consistent, high quality Inspection across a variety of different components and product families
- Maintaining a high level of process compliance and sustainment, including calibration of gauges and measurement equipment
- Operate a variety of manual and digital inspection equipment, including CMM, articulated arms/ laser tracker, Borescopes and 1st principal measurements
- Interpreting manufacturing drawings and written specifications
- Assessing components produced within the facility against quality standards
- Working within a team to effectively resolve quality issues and ensure work is being completed to plan
- The ability to make decisions giving suitable justifications for your conclusions
- Working within a team to effectively resolve any issues which arise
- Working closely with internal and external customers to continuously improve business performance
My profile
The successful candidate should have the following qualifications and/or experience:
- NVQ Level 3 engineering apprenticeship (inspection related)
- Experience in 1st Principle bench inspection
- Experience in operating CMM’s and/or Articulated Arms/ Laser Trackers
- Clear and demonstrated understanding of drawing interpretation, calibration requirements, dimensional and visual inspection
- An ideal candidate would be pro-active and capable of managing their time effectively
- Experience in the use of Microsoft Office applications
- Awareness of HS&E requirements
